WebCOPE is a non-profit organization dedicated to promoting integrity in research and its publication. Crucially, it is a non-statutory body which provides practical publication ethics guidance for editors and publishers working in all research disciplines. Founded by journal editors in 1997 as a response to growing concerns about the integrity of ...
